Christian Benteke has been under a lot of criticism after he missed a penalty against Bournemouth at the weekend, however there’s some interior Crystal Palace drama as boss Roy Hodgson reveals he was wrong to take it.

There’s nothing worse for fans to see than a manager slating his players, but that’s whats happened in at Selhurst Park. Is it just some petty Crystal Palace drama, or is this something that fans should be worried about?

There was late drama in the game between the Cherries and the Eagles, with Christian Benteke opting to take the late penalty, and ultimately failing to convert it into a goal, which would have secured the three points for Palace.

There was a lot of controversy, as there usually is, on social media, saying that Luka Milivojevic should have been the one to take the huge responsibility. The Serbian midfielder had already converted a penalty earlier on in the game, so you can understand the frustration.

According to Goal, the frustration was emphasised by the Crystal Palace boss, which is always strange to see.

“It was an unilateral decision, no-one on our team was able to wrest the ball from him. We, the management, decide who the penalty takers are and don’t expect players during the course of the game to change those decisions.” – Roy Hodgson on Christian Benteke (via Goal)

You can see the passive aggression in the Crystal Palace manager’s words, which epitomizes the thoughts of the Eagles faithful. Judging by this, you would imagine they’ve had a lot of emphasis on penalties in training, and they’ve had a rule broken by the Belgian striker.
